Fix configure regexp for enabling FFmpeg features All features were disabled because of a regexp that used "[^ ]" to match start of a word. '^' is not a metacharacter meaning beginning of line inside [], instead it inverts the matching condition of the other characters in the list. Changed to use "\<" and "\>" for start/end of word instead. I don't know how standard those are, at least they're better than the previous version.
